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
076 7815856 2990 70907208 32412
12 9735056120 66238957
12 9735056120 66238957
0141812683 89 9191900 11039295
All about undefined
Interested in learning more?
12 9735056120 66238957
0141812683 89 9191900 11039295
See more
4341418964 43322286 786354954
031809 89573 96708434091 648348
See more
30 85970635510
990 936981 23 66498
See more